Do not pack the following items in your hand luggage:

  • Leave all your full-sized bottles of shampoo and hair gel in your checked baggage. Any gels or liquids in your carry-on suitcase larger than 3.4 ounces (100 milliliters) will be confiscated by security. Sharp objects, like a pocket knife, and products which are explosive or flammable, such as aerosol cans, flares and gasoline, are also not allowed.

  • The condition called deep vein thrombosis (DVT) can pose a risk on long-haul flights. It results from blood clotting due to poor circulation. Walking around the cabin and doing regular leg and foot exercises in your seat helps to prevent this developing. Wearing a good-quality pair of compression tights or socks also helps reduce the risk.

How to get through airport security fast when flying to Baalbek?
Being organised before your flight can make your trip to Baalbek a pleasure. Read through our handy tips for a stress-free journey past security:

  • First things first. Your passport and boarding pass will need to be shown to airport security personnel. Keep them at hand so you don’t hold up the line.
  • Your coat, belt, keys and other contents of your pockets, like your headphones, will need to go on a tray through the X-ray machine. Make the whole process easier by removing them as your turn draws near.
  • Electronic devices like laptops and phones will also have to go through the machine for inspection. Don’t worry though, you’ll be back online in no time.
  • Travelling with a new perfume? No problem. As long as it’s in a container no larger than 3.4 ounces (100 milliliters) and it’s stored in a zip-lock bag, you can bring it with you on board.
  • Choosing your footwear wisely can save you several valuable minutes. Hiking boots are often required to be removed and X-rayed separately. Lightweight sneakers are usually not.
  • Airlines won’t allow any sharp or pointed objects to come on board with you. If you must bring these kinds of items, pack them safely in your checked luggage.
